Four Ways To Build A Career In Chevron

Although there are many oil companies that an individual could opt to work for, striving for employment with Chevron Oil can be particularly beneficial. This is the case for many reasons, including the fact that pay is competitive and there are opportunities for upward mobility. If you’re interested in cultivating a career with Chevron, the following four strategies can help you accomplish your objective:

1. Start Off On The Right Foot.

One of the most important strategies to implement when you begin to build a career in Chevron is to get off to a great start. There are several ways that you can accomplish this objective, including by being attentive and following instructions, both of which will prepare you to perform your job assignments with expedience and excellence. Additionally, you should take the time to learn as much about the company and its mission statement as possible. Doing so will provide you with a better understanding of the company culture, thereby enabling you to fit in and contribute to the type of environment that is conducive to productivity.

2. Build Relationships.

Yet another strategy you should implement during the course of time you spend building your career in Chevron is to build relationships. This is incredibly important for many reasons, including the fact that you will be working with your boss and co-workers for extended periods of time. Since this is the case, you’ll want to know them relatively well and maintain positive, mutually beneficial relationships with them. Although the relationship-building process may seem overwhelming or vague, it can be as simple as bringing a sick co-worker a get well card or going out to lunch with the person in the cubicle beside you.

3. Invest In On-going Education.

If you’re serious about cultivating a meaningful career with Chevron, it’s a good idea to invest in continuing education courses (CECs). Doing so is important for several reasons, including the fact that it shows your employer you’re interested in expanding your skill set and knowledge of the oil industry. Additionally, employees who take the initiative to get more education will oftentimes be considered first when it’s time for promotions and raises.

4. Focus On Accomplishments, Not Job Titles.

In many cases, people equate career development with promotions that give them significant job titles such as “Executive Director.” However, your value and efficacy within a company is not always contingent upon what title you hold. Rather, it is often based on what you actually accomplish while at work, irrespective of the position you hold while doing so. For this reason, it’s a good idea to concentrate on making notable accomplishments (like increasing conversion rates or reducing spills) in order to develop a substantive career.
